  1. About. Elise Mertens has surely claimed her spot at the top of the WTA ranks. After capturing her first WTA singles and doubles titles in 2017, the Belgian jumped from World No.120 at the end of 2016 to No.35 by the end of the 2017 season. 2018 was a pivotal year for Elise, successfully defending her title at Hobart and capturing two additional singles titles at Lugano and Rabat.

  2. Nov 17, 1995 · The 2019 and 2021 Indian Wells doubles champion, Elise Mertens returns to the desert as one of the most accomplished doubles players of her era. The Belgian boasts three Grand Slam doubles titles with her victories at the 2019 US Open, 2021 Australian Open (both with Aryna Sabalenka) and 2021 Wimbledon (with Su-wei Hsieh).

  5. Elise Mertens Early Life. Mertens was born in Leuven, Belgium on November 17, 1995. She was introduced to the game of tennis by her elder sister Lauren at the age of four.
